Background:
This study aimed to assess the impact of caloric intake and weight-for-age-Z-score after the Norwood procedure on the outcome of bidirectional cavopulmonary shunt.
Methods:A total of 153 neonates who underwent the Norwood procedure between 2012 and 2020 were surveyed. Postoperative daily caloric intake and weight-for-age-Z-score up to five months were calculated, and their impact on outcome after bidirectional cavopulmonary shunt was analysed.
Results:Median age and weight at the Norwood procedure were 9 days and 3.2 kg, respectively. Modified Blalock-Taussig shunt was used in 95 patients and right ventricle to pulmonary artery conduit in 58. Postoperatively, total caloric intake gradually increased, whereas weight-for-age-Z-score constantly decreased. Early and inter-stage mortality before stage II correlated with low caloric intake. Older age (p = 0.023) at Norwood, lower weight (p < 0.001) at Norwood, and longer intubation (p = 0.004) were correlated with low weight-for-age-Z-score (< –3.0) at 2 months of age. Patients with weight-for-age-Z-score < –3.0 at 2 months of age had lower survival after stage II compared to those with weight-for-age-Z-score of –3.0 or more (85.3 versus 92.9% at 3 years after stage II, p = 0.017). There was no difference between inter-stage weight gain and survival after bidirectional cavopulmonary shunt between the shunt types.
Conclusion:Weight-for-age-Z-score decreased continuously throughout the first 5 months after the Norwood procedure. Age and weight at Norwood and intubation time were associated with weight gain. Inter-stage low weight gain (Z-score < –3) was a risk for survival after stage II.

Objective:
The purpose of this study is to evaluate the incidence and outcomes regarding tachyarrhythmia in patients after total cavopulmonary connection.
Methods:A retrospective analysis of 620 patients who underwent total cavopulmonary connection between 1994 and 2021 at our institution was performed. Incidence of tachyarrhythmia was depicted, and results after onset of tachyarrhythmia were evaluated. Factors associated with the onset of tachyarrhythmia were identified.
Results:A total of 52 (8%) patients presented with tachyarrhythmia that required medical therapy. Onset during hospital stay was observed in 27 patients, and onset after hospital discharge was observed in 32 patients. Freedom from late tachyarrhythmia following total cavopulmonary connection at 5, 10, and 15 years was 97, 95, and 91%, respectively. The most prevalent late tachyarrhythmia was atrial flutter (50%), followed by supraventricular tachycardia (25%) and ventricular tachycardia (25%). Direct current cardioversion was required in 12 patients, and 7 patients underwent electrophysiological study. Freedom from Fontan circulatory failure after onset of tachyarrhythmia at 10 and 15 years was 78% and 49%, respectively. Freedom from occurrence of decreased ventricular systolic function after the onset of tachyarrhythmia at 5 years was 85%. Independent factors associated with late tachyarrhythmia were dominant right ventricle (hazard ratio, 2.52, p = 0.02) and weight at total cavopulmonary connection (hazard ratio, 1.03 per kilogram; p = 0.04). Type of total cavopulmonary connection at total cavopulmonary connection was not identified as risk.
Conclusions:In our large cohort of 620 patients following total cavopulmonary connection, the incidence of late tachyarrhythmia was low. Patients with dominant right ventricle and late total cavopulmonary connection were at increased risk for late tachyarrhythmia following total cavopulmonary connection.

Background:
Brady-arrhythmia requiring pacemaker implantation remains one of the Fontan-specific complications before and after total cavopulmonary connection.
Methods:A retrospective analysis of 620 patients who underwent total cavopulmonary connection between 1994 and 2021 was performed to evaluate the incidence of brady-arrhythmia and the outcomes after pacemaker implantation. Factors associated with the onset of brady-arrhythmia were identified.
Results:A total of 52 patients presented with brady-arrhythmia and required pacemaker implantation. Diagnosis included 16 sinus node dysfunctions, 29 atrioventricular blocks, and 7 junctional escape rhythms. Pacemaker implantation was performed before total cavopulmonary connection (n = 16), concomitant with total cavopulmonary connection (n = 8), or after total cavopulmonary connection (n = 28, median 1.8 years post-operatively). Freedom from pacemaker implantation following total cavopulmonary connection at 10 years was 92%. Twelve patients needed revision of electrodes due to lead dysfunction (n = 9), infections (n = 2), or dislocation (n = 1). Lead energy thresholds were stable, and freedom from pacemaker lead revision at 10 years after total cavopulmonary connection was 78%. Congenitally corrected transposition of the great arteries (odds ratio: 6.6, confidence interval: 2.0–21.5, p = 0.002) was identified as a factor associated with pacemaker implantation before total cavopulmonary connection. Pacemaker rhythms for Fontan circulation were not a risk factor for survival (p = 0.226), protein-losing enteropathy/plastic bronchitis (p = 0.973), or thromboembolic complications (p = 0.424).
Conclusions:In our cohort of patients following total cavopulmonary connection, freedom from pacemaker implantation at 10 years was 92% and stable atrial and ventricular lead energy thresholds were observed. Congenitally corrected transposition of the great arteries was at increased risk for pacemaker implantation before total cavopulmonary connection. Having a pacemaker in the Fontan circulation had no adverse effect on survival, protein-losing enteropathy/plastic bronchitis, or thromboembolic complications.
